WebKilve Beach and East Quantoxhead. 3 miles (5.5 km) This circular walk explores a beautiful area of coast and countryside in the Quantocks. The walk starts at the large car park just north of Kilve. It's a short walk from here to the fascinating Kilve Beach. Part of the Jurassic coastline the beach is a good place for fossil hunting.
